Freshman Musical Clubs

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The Freshman Glee, Banjo and Mandolin Clubs have been rehearsing regularly for three months, and as the material is excellent the concerts promise to be successful. The Glee Club has the largest number of men and is particularly good this year. So far the following concerts have been arranged, after each of which an informal dance will be held: May 8, Brattle Hall, Cambridge; May 18, Whitney Hall, Brookline; May 23, Newton Club Hall, Newtonville.
